Course Details
• Introduction to Energy System Resilience: Understanding the importance of resilience in energy systems, the need for robust and reliable energy infrastructure, and the consequences of energy system failures.
• Energy Infrastructure and System Design: Exploring the design and operation of energy systems, including power generation, transmission, and distribution, and their impact on system resilience.
• Risk Assessment and Management in Energy Systems: Identifying and assessing potential risks in energy systems, and implementing effective risk management strategies to improve system resilience.
• Microgrids and Decentralized Energy Systems: Understanding the role of microgrids and decentralized energy systems in improving energy system resilience, and the benefits and challenges of implementing these systems.
• Energy Storage Technologies: Examining the latest energy storage technologies, including batteries, pumped hydro storage, and thermal storage, and their impact on energy system resilience.
• Climate Change and Energy System Resilience: Investigating the impact of climate change on energy systems, and the role of energy system resilience in mitigating the effects of climate change.
• Energy Efficiency and Conservation: Exploring the role of energy efficiency and conservation in improving energy system resilience, and the benefits and challenges of implementing these strategies.
• Policy and Regulation for Energy System Resilience: Understanding the policy and regulatory landscape for energy system resilience, including key legislation, regulations, and standards.
• Emerging Trends in Energy System Resilience: Investigating the latest trends and innovations in energy system resilience, including smart grids, renewable energy, and advanced technologies.
